Why You Shouldn't Drive on a Damaged Drive
With large defects, further operation threatens with the complete destruction of the product, which is most likely to happen when driving on a bad road or hitting an obstacle. If the damage is minor, other troubles are coming:
- ? wheel imbalance leading to steering wheel vibrations and rapid tread wear
- ? a jam in the edge of the rim leads to the passage of air: the tire will have to be constantly pumped up
In such cases, it is more reasonable to show the disc to a specialist in order to decide whether the product needs to be repaired or whether a new one will have to be bought. It is quite difficult to implement the latter option if the disc is light-alloy and has an original design. It is unlikely to find exactly the same product and you will have to buy four pieces, which will cost a pretty penny. The first step is to determine if repairs can be done.
When a disk is unrecoverable
Damage can be conditionally divided into several types - cracks, chipping fragments and jams. In the presence of the first type of damage, it is highly not recommended to make repairs if the defects are:
- ? in the area of the base of the spokes at the hub
- ? near the holes for the studs or mounting bolts
After repairing such damage by welding, it is impossible to guarantee the continued safety of the product. And its use is risky.

If damage has appeared in the center of the disc or on the rim, it is not recommended to use welding or heating during the restoration procedure. When using these methods, the load is concentrated in the weakest places. When driving on poor-quality roads, the disc can easily collapse, which at high speed is fraught with an accident.
With severe defects in the inner part and intact front, you may be offered a “super option” - to weld the back side from the donor disk. This is also a very risky method: it is impossible to predict what will happen to such a product in the future. Proposals of this kind must be flatly rejected. There is only one option here - buying a new part.
roller rolling
The purpose of the procedure is to return the disk to the correct geometric shape using a special machine. Steel and light-alloy products can be repaired by this method. During the operation, the rollers roll over the damaged area or the entire rim. If the disc is steel, it may be heated, for light-alloy products this is unacceptable, because the internal structure (crystal lattice) of the material is violated.
The quality of work depends not only on the availability of a professional machine, but also on the experience of the master.
Simple defects are corrected manually with constant control on machine equipment with the help of special tools.
Rolling is used for relatively small damages, but if they are significant, straightening is preliminarily performed using hydraulic equipment. A similar option is used when restoring cast, conventional steel and, in some cases, forged wheels.
The cost of rolling depends on the diameter of the product and the material of its manufacture. Starts from 500 rubles.
hydraulic straightening
Requires special equipment that will allow you to straighten dents, regardless of their location. The machine has a lot of stops and jacks. In the course of work there is a constant control by means of a measuring needle.
The deformed disk is minimally affected, since no heat is used, the internal structure of the material remains unchanged. At the same time, the pressure exerted on the product is constantly regulated, depending on the nature and severity of the damage.
Argon welding
It can be used to eliminate cracks formed, for example, on spokes-beams. Although theoretically, with the help of argon welding, any damage can be repaired, up to the fixation of a completely broken element. However, no one will give a guarantee for such work, and the responsible master will not undertake it.
When welding small fragments, sealing cracks, the material of manufacture is determined by the nature of the damage. This is necessary to pick up an additive. The disc burst - it contains silicon, bent - there is a lot of magnesium in the alloy. Based on this, the wire for welding is selected. At the end of the work, the product is subjected to grinding, polishing, sometimes painting, then balanced.
Estimated cost of 1 cm of argon welding seam is 150 rubles, surfacing of the edge is from 300 to 400 rubles. for the same centimeter.
Sledgehammer and hammer
The old tried and true method. It is used for slight curvatures, to prepare the disc for rolling with rollers. But here you need a good experience: the wrong “step to the left, step to the right” - the wheel will be irretrievably damaged. Another restoration method is straightening with a pneumatic jack (pictured below).
This procedure is suitable for steel stampings.
Is it possible to restore a forged wheel
When hitting obstacles, falling into pits, these products behave in much the same way as steel ones. Forged wheels are bent, dents form on them: that is, they are deformed, but not destroyed. However, repair is advisable only for minor defects. If the disk is rolled using heat, its structure will be disturbed and if it hits even a small hole, the wheel will become “oval”. Welding of a forged product is possible, but only to eliminate small cracks, provided that they are not located at the hub or mounting holes.
Painting
Deterioration in appearance is the least trouble that can happen to a rim. It is better to return attractiveness with the help of powder paint. Before the procedure, the product is thoroughly cleaned with abrasive agents or sandblasting to remove traces of corrosion, the old coating.
An electrostatic gun is used to apply paint: the particles of the composition stick to the surface not due to adhesion, but due to the charge.
After painting, the product is dried in a special oven, providing a temperature of +200 °. The duration of the process is fifteen minutes.
You can also use acrylic paint, sold in aerosol cans. It says so on them: "for rims." It is important to remember here: the quality of the painting is highly dependent on the thoroughness of the surface preparation. The slightest traces of corrosion, left by accident (or due to inaccessibility), will then crawl out.
How to determine the quality of a used disc
At today's prices, buying a non-new disc is a standard occurrence. And it's not just the cost. It happens that it is impossible to find a wheel of the same design in stores, and buying 4 new ones is expensive. The way out is the secondary market. You can determine the suitability of the product and understand whether it has been repaired or not by external inspection:
- ? dark areas on the rim indicate the application of heat during restoration of the disc
- ? the absence of markings on the back side (characteristics, dimensions, date of manufacture) may indicate a repair
- ? traces of balancing weights also "inform" about the restoration of the product
Today, traces of restoration work can be masked so that the average user cannot identify them. Only an experienced craftsman can accurately understand whether a disk has been repaired.
